Great news for the open data community: CivicActions is taking over core product responsibility for DKAN!

As one of the original DKAN co-founders, I’m really excited about this. CivicActions is technically strong, experienced and organizationally committed in many key areas for DKAN project leadership:

  • absolute commitment to open, collaboratively-built software, including active contribution to numerous open source communities
  • enterprise procurement, services, and support experience serving some of the largest and most complex governments in the world
  • long-standing experience delivering on complex open data and data visualization use cases
  • track record of successfully driving Agile process on government projects

I’ve known the CivicActions team for a long time and am thrilled they are assuming DKAN product leadership from Granicus, including support to many of the Granicus Open Data clients, and welcoming the DKAN-focused staff to its team.

I’d also like to thank Granicus for their years of generous support of the project, as well as their enablement of this great new chapter for DKAN by handing the core product reins over to CivicActions.
